In 1587, over 100 English settlers vanished from Roanoke Island—leaving behind no bodies, no signs of struggle, and only a single word carved into a post: CROATOAN. What happened to the Lost Colony? In this episode of Brewed and Bewildered, we unravel one of America’s most enduring historical mysteries. Explore the real story behind Roanoke through colonial records, recent archaeological discoveries, and the leading theories—from assimilation with Native tribes to hostile encounters and deadly relocation attempts.Perfect for fans of unsolved mysteries, American history, and true crime podcasts, this episode digs deep into the roots of early colonial America—and a disappearance that still haunts the timeline.
